Kumasi Trio
This article deals with the transcultural popular music styles of sub-Saharan Africa that has evolved since the 19th century as a blend of local elements and imported ones from the West, Islam and the black diaspora of the Americas. The latter has acted as a catalyst in the creation of many African popular music genres even in colonial times and can be treated as a black musical ‘homecoming’ (A. A. Mensah, 1971), ‘cultural feedback’ (Stearns, 1988), ‘affinity’ (Roberts, 1974) or ‘resonance’ (Jacobs, 1989).
